How To Prepare For Faang Data Engineering Interviews

 thumbnail

How To Prepare For Faang Data Engineering Interviews

Published Mar 08, 25
7 min read
[=headercontent]Cracking The Mid-level Software Engineer Interview – Part I (Concepts & Frameworks) [/headercontent] [=image]
What Faang Companies Look For In Data Engineering Candidates

How To Ace The Software Engineering Interview – Insider Strategies




[/video]

At the very same time, they desire to recognize you can sense the best time to relocate forward no matter of your argument. Amazon counts on a culture of development. Interviewers desire to see that you are delighted to dive deep when problems arise.

Tell me regarding a project in which you had to deep study evaluation Tell me concerning one of the most intricate trouble you have worked with Define a circumstances when you utilized a lot of information in a brief time period Are right, a whole lot"Leaders are right a whole lot. They believe differently and take a look around corners for ways to serve customers." Amazon is big and its SDEs need to develop products that get to considerable range to make a distinction for the organization. Because of this, recruiters will desire to see that you can create and express a vibrant vision. Why was it substantial? Employ and create the most effective"Leaders increase the efficiency bar with every hire and promo. They acknowledge remarkable ability, and voluntarily relocate them throughout the company. Leaders establish leaders and take seriously their function in training others. We deal with part of our individuals to develop systems for growth like Profession Option."As stated above, Amazon wants new hires to"elevate the bar. "Interviewers will certainly intend to see that you are not terrified of functioning with and hiring individuals smarter than you. You'll notice the instances noted right here are general interview questions, however they provide a best opportunity for you to resolve this concept.

This leadership principle is typically reviewed in meetings for really elderly design settings that entail people monitoring or building a team(e.g. Software Development Supervisor, Director, and so on ). At every touchpoint, Amazon tries to give customers with as much worth for as little cost as feasible. Some examples noted below are basic meeting questions, however they provide an ideal chance for you to resolve this principle.

They lead with compassion, have enjoyable at the workplace, and make it simple for others to have a good time. Leaders ask themselves: Are my fellow workers expanding? Are they equipped? Are they prepared wherefore's next? Leaders dream for and dedication to their staff members'individual success, whether that be at Amazon or in other places. "Comparable to the concept" hire and create the very best," this principle is most likely to find up in meetings for senior and/or supervisory placements. We are huge, we affect the world, and we are much from ideal. We need to be modest and thoughtful regarding even the additional effects of our activities. Our neighborhood communities , earth, and future generations need us to be much better daily. We must start each day with a decision to make better, do much better, and be better for our clients, our workers, our companions, and the world at large. You should constantly be eager to boost. Offer me an instance of when you chose that impacted the team or the firm Can you tell me a decision that you made concerning your work that you regret now? Sometimes, if you're a fresh graduate applicant, you may also get inquiries on computer technology basics as stated in this Medium article. You could be a fantastic software application designer, but sadly, that will not be adequate to ace your meetings at Amazon. Interviewing is a skill by itself, that you require to discover. Allow's check out some vital pointers to make certain you approach your interviews in the right means. Typically the inquiries you'll be asked will certainly be fairly ambiguous, so make certain you ask questions that can assist you make clear and recognize the trouble. Constantly make use of particular info and never generalize.

The Key Steps To Prepare For A Software Engineer Interview – Best Practices

The Best Machine Learning & Ai Courses For Software Engineers


The most effective means to do this is to prepare a single particular example of a previous experience to show your response to an inquiry. When speaking about your previous accomplishments, Bilwasiva, Amazon interview coach recommends measuring your accomplishments anywhere possible."Use metrics and data to demonstrate the influence of your contributions. "You need to walk your job interviewer with your thought procedure before you really begin coding.

The Ultimate Guide To Data Science Interview Preparation

or developing a system. Your interviewer may likewise offer you hints regarding whether you're on the appropriate track or not. In your system design interview, you need to explicitly state assumptions and consult your job interviewer to see if those presumptions are affordable. When you code, present multiple feasible options if you can. Amazon wishes to know your thinking forpicking a particular service. While we stated the very first 4 values as the ones given emphasis in SDE interviews, the finest means to prepare is to have at least one story for each LP. To be more reliable, you can adapt your stories so they can reply to different management concepts. Maintain your code organized so your recruiter will not have a tough time comprehending what you have actually created. While your code will not be tested, you'll be a lot more outstanding if you create testable code. Prepare to clarify the Time/Space Complexity of your remedies, and just how to much better maximize for Time/Space Complexity. Additionally, do not use random/variable feature names. Be sure to compose descriptive, significant ones. Amazon advises SDE prospects to be prepared to compose code in real-time on an online editor. You can check with your employer which it will be if you're unsure which medium to make use of. Now that you know what concerns to expect, let's concentrate on how to.

prepare. Below are the four preparation steps we suggest to assist you get an offer as an Amazon (or Amazon Internet Provider)software program growth engineer. If you understand engineers who function at Amazon or used to work there, talk to them to comprehend what the society is like. The Leadership Principles we went over above can offer you a sense of what to expect, but there's no replacement for a discussion

Anonymous Coding & Technical Interview Prep For Software Engineers

The Complete Guide To Software Engineering Interview Preparation


with an expert. We would certainly likewise advise taking a look at the list below resources: As discussed above, you'll need to respond to 3 kinds of concerns at Amazon: coding, system design, and behavioral. Right here is a recap of the approach: Action 1: Ask explanation inquiries Recognize the goal of the system(e.g. market ebooks) Establish the scope of the workout(e.g. end-to-end experience, or simply API?) Collect range and performance needs(e.g. 500 transactions per secondly) Reference any type of assumptions you're constructing loud Step 2: Layout at a high level after that pierce down Lay out the high-level parts (e.g. Play the function of both the prospect and the interviewer, asking questions and addressing them, much like two individuals would certainly in an interview. Nevertheless, on your own, you can't imitate believing on your feet or the stress of performing in front of an unfamiliar person. Plus, there are no unexpected follow-up concerns and no feedback. That's an ROI of 100x!. Selection and String Control: Learn techniques for sorting, looking, and rearranging selections and strings. Dynamic Shows: Research usual patterns like memoization and tabulation.

The Best Free Coursera Courses For Technical Interview Preparation

Graph Problems: BFS, DFS, Dijkstra's algorithm, and extra. Binary Trees and Lots: Concentrate on traversal, insertion, and removal formulas. Backtracking and Recursion: Obtain comfy with problems that need discovering different opportunities.

Graph Problems: BFS, DFS, Dijkstra's algorithm, and extra. Binary Trees and Plenty: Focus on traversal, insertion, and removal algorithms. Backtracking and Recursion: Get comfortable with problems that require exploring various opportunities.

What Is The Star Method & How To Use It In Tech Interviews?

Best Ai & Machine Learning Courses For Faang Interviews


Graph Troubles: BFS, DFS, Dijkstra's algorithm, and more. Binary Trees and Plenty: Emphasis on traversal, insertion, and deletion algorithms. Backtracking and Recursion: Obtain comfy with troubles that call for discovering different opportunities.

Top Software Engineering Interview Questions And How To Answer Them

Chart Troubles: BFS, DFS, Dijkstra's formula, and much more. Binary Trees and Lots: Concentrate on traversal, insertion, and deletion formulas. Backtracking and Recursion: Obtain comfortable with issues that call for exploring various possibilities.

Software Developer Career Guide – From Interview Prep To Job Offers

The Best Machine Learning & Ai Courses For Software Engineers


Graph Troubles: BFS, DFS, Dijkstra's algorithm, and extra. Binary Trees and Heaps: Concentrate on traversal, insertion, and removal formulas. Backtracking and Recursion: Get comfortable with issues that call for checking out various opportunities.

22 Senior Software Engineer Interview Questions (And How To Answer Them)

Graph Troubles: BFS, DFS, Dijkstra's formula, and more. Binary Trees and Loads: Concentrate on traversal, insertion, and deletion formulas. Backtracking and Recursion: Get comfortable with issues that call for exploring different opportunities.

Chart Problems: BFS, DFS, Dijkstra's algorithm, and extra. Binary Trees and Loads: Concentrate on traversal, insertion, and removal algorithms. Backtracking and Recursion: Obtain comfy with troubles that need discovering different opportunities.